Welcome! I'm Benjamin K. Gudorf, a dedicated Family Nurse Practitioner with a passion for primary care and diabetes education. With a Master's from the University of Cincinnati and extensive experience in urgent care, I'm equipped to handle a wide range of health needs. Whether you're looking for guidance on managing diabetes with the latest insulin pump technologies or need support with sleep apnea treatments, I'm here to provide personalized care.
My journey in healthcare began with earning my Bachelor's in Nursing from Wright State University, followed by serving in the US Army Nursing Corps where I gained diverse medical experience. Since then, I've been committed to expanding my expertise, including becoming a Certified Diabetic Care and Education Specialist and mastering CPAP titration for sleep apnea.
I believe in empowering patients through education and collaborative care. My approach is all about making sure you feel heard and supported every step of the way. From walk-in urgent care needs to ongoing management of chronic conditions, I'm here to ensure you receive top-notch care tailored just for you.
Outside the clinic, I stay up-to-date with the latest healthcare advancements to bring you the best possible outcomes. Holding certifications from the Ohio Board of Nursing, AANP, and several other specialized credentials, I'm always ready to put my knowledge to work for your health.
Let's work together to achieve your wellness goals!

How to prepare for video visits and what to expect?
For a video visit, you will need a computer or smartphone equipped with a camera and microphone. Prior to your appointment, please use the link provided in your confirmation email to ensure that your device is compatible with the video visit. If you're using an iPhone, it's recommended that you access the visit through the Safari browser for optimal performance.
